On a South Pacific island during World War II, Ensign Nellie Forbush, a spunky nurse from Arkansas, falls in love with French planter Emile de Becque but she refuses Emile’s proposal of marriage, unable to overcome the prejudices with which she was raised. Meanwhile, Lt. Joe Cable falls in love with a Tonkinese girl named Liat, but he too denies himself a future due to the same fears that haunt Nellie. When Emile accompanies Joe on a dangerous mission, Nellie chooses to embrace a future with Emile, thus conquering her prejudices.
The show received ten Tony Awards (including Best Musical), a Grammy Award, and countless other accolades.
